Output 18f601a276d2c8a5f6a1a9a3ddd357fa17ce5596f5621f3a19bcfd4ee2598860:0

value
1550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f494a7190983fd59755177f0dcf4f58e82bd7f0e OP_EQUAL
address
3PzEsvUg21XZGKUMiG7dpn4sdGfbLKhvqY
transaction
18f601a276d2c8a5f6a1a9a3ddd357fa17ce5596f5621f3a19bcfd4ee2598860
spent
true